Outline of Final Research Achievements

The resting 12-lead electrocardiogram (ECG) was a predictive tool for atherosclerotic cardiovascular (CV) events in not only hypertensives but also non-hypertensives. In addtion, a combination of traditional risk factors and ECG leaded to the improvement of CV risk classification. Furthermore, The plasma B-type natriuretic peptide (BNP), the biomarker of future CV risk, had a predictive value of CV disease in addition to the ECG.
